To provide a completely sealed type guide device in a pantograph region of a high speed train.SOLUTION: A completely sealed type guide device includes a fairing and driving devices, in which the fairing is installed in a streamline dome type or a water droplet type, symmetrically has two side wings, has a lower arm frame hole and a tie rod hole bored at the center, a pantograph is installed in the fearing, the lower arm frame hole and the tie rod hole are used so that a lower arm frame and a tie rod of the pantograph pass therethrough, the driving devices are symmetrically installed in two groups and are connected to each of the two side wings, and the driving device is used for opening/closing the side wings, and driving the rotation. The guide device does not give an influence on the function of the pantograph itself. When the pantograph is lowered, the pantograph is completely closed. When the pantograph is raised, an influence of an air flow of a base and the rod at a lower part of the pantograph, and the pantograph region to a cavity is reduced, and resistance and noise are reduced.SELECTED DRAWING: Figure 1
